Dynamisch eingebundene Vis in EXE finden - Druckversion +- LabVIEWForum.de (https://www.labviewforum.de) +-- Forum: LabVIEW (/Forum-LabVIEW) +--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ein) +---- Forum: Application Builder (/Forum-Application-Builder) +---- Thema: Dynamisch eingebundene Vis in EXE finden (/Thread-Dynamisch-eingebundene-Vis-in-EXE-finden) Seiten: 1 2 |
Dynamisch eingebundene Vis in EXE finden - rolfk - 05.07.2007 08:52 ' schrieb:Eine interessante Sache will ich hier noch verraten. Wenn man die EXE in LLB umbenennt und mit LV aufmacht, kann man sogar das eine oder das andere VI mit einem anderen ersetzen. Deshalb immer die Passwortabfrage oder irgendwelche sicherheitsrelevante Sachen im Main erledigen. Erstens: Das funkts nicht mehr in LabVIEW 8.2 unter Windows, da die LabVIEW Resourcen anders in das Executable eingebaut werden und die LabVIEW Funktionen nur soweit angepasst wurden, dass nur noch das eigene Executable diese sehen kann. Alle Benützerzugänglichen Funktionen können die interne LLB in einem executable nicht mehr sehen. Zweitens: Ausser wenn Du ein Debugbuild machst, was erst ab LabVIEW 8 sinnvoll und wirklich möglich ist ohne ganz tief in LabVIEW zu tauchen, ist das Diagram aus allen VIs weg und die Frontpanels werden ausser für UserInterfaces und dynamische VIs normalerweise ebenfalls ganz entfernt. Wenn Du mit dem was übrig bleibt noch sehr viel machen kannst dann bist Du ziemlich clever. Ich sage nicht dass überhaupt nichts mehr möglich ist aber der Nutzen einer solchen "LLB" ist sehr gering, da sie nur in genau der gleichen LabVIEW Version läuft dann in der in der sie erstellt wurde. Rolf Kalbermatter |